Hi, below I have a code to solve symbolically differential equation.
My question is simple:
How to present the solution in linear form instead of exponential form. So basically what is the code to logarithm symbolically function on both sides of the solved equation?
syms A(t) k A0
R = -diff(A) == k*A;
cond = A(0) == A0;
A(t) = dsolve(R,cond)

Use 'simplify' function on applying log on both sides of equation
z= log(A(t));
logA = simplify(z , 'IgnoreAnalyticConstraints', true);
